<p>Volcanism and history are featured here. The hike onto Black Crater is less than 0.3 miles (0.5 km) by bearing right. The battlefield is 1.1 miles (1.8km) one way. View fine wildflower displays in season.</p> <p>Lava Beds has twelve hiking trails. The most popular trails ar…

<p>This trail climbs 0.7 miles (1.4 km) to the fire lookout and a panoramic view. Trail has a 500 -foot elevation gain. You can be a guest of the lookout on duty in summer. Please stay on the designated trail and do not shortcut switchbacks.</p> <p>Lava Beds has twelve hiking…
